[發明專利]物體深度的檢測方法、裝置和系統有效
| 申請號: | 201210166092.1 | 申請日: | 2012-05-24 |
| 公開(公告)號: | CN103424083A | 公開(公告)日: | 2013-12-04 |
| 發明(設計)人: | 王行;王貴錦 | 申請(專利權)人: | 北京數碼視訊科技股份有限公司 |
| 主分類號: | G01B11/22 | 分類號: | G01B11/22 |
| 代理公司: | 北京康信知識產權代理有限責任公司 11240 | 代理人: | 吳貴明;余剛 |
| 地址: | 100085 北京市海淀區*** | 國省代碼: | 北京;11 |
| 權利要求書: | 查看更多 | 說明書: | 查看更多 |
| 摘要: | |||
| 搜索關鍵詞: | 物體 深度 檢測 方法 裝置 系統 | ||
技術領域
本發明涉及檢測領域,具體而言,涉及一種物體深度的檢測方法、裝置和系統。
背景技術
目前,對于物體深度信息的獲取主要包括以下的步驟:通過兩個處于不同角度的攝像頭拍攝物體來計算物體的視差值,同時通過視差值來獲取物體深度信息。該運算主要對色彩圖像進行不同視差的運算,運算量大并且成本較高,導致物體深度檢測效率低,而且在拍攝過程中容易受到光照的影響,在比較暗的環境中很難獲取到物體的深度信息。
針對相關技術物體深度檢測效率低的問題,目前尚未提出有效的解決方案。
發明內容
本發明的主要目的在于提供一種物體深度的檢測方法、裝置和系統,以解決物體深度檢測效率低的問題。
為了實現上述目的,根據本發明的一個方面,提供了一種物體深度的檢測方法。
根據本發明的物體深度的檢測方法包括:圖像發射裝置向被測物體發射預設光學圖像;攝像裝置采集經被測物體調制后的光學圖像,得到目標圖像,其中,圖像發射裝置與攝像裝置間隔預設距離;計算目標圖像相對參考圖像的視差值,其中,參考圖像為攝像裝置采集圖像發射裝置發射至平面的預設光學圖像得到的圖像;以及根據視差值計算被測物體的深度值。
進一步地,圖像發射裝置為紅外激光發射器,攝像裝置包括濾波器,其中,濾波器用于濾除外部環境中除紅外激光之外的其他波長的光線。
進一步地,計算目標圖像相對參考圖像的視差值包括:計算目標圖像的像素點與參考圖像中視差移動范圍內各個像素點的相關值,得到多個相關值;確定最大相關值點,其中,最大相關值點為是視差移動范圍內各個像素點中,與最大的相關值對應的像素點;以及確定目標圖像的像素點相對最大相關值點的視差值。
進一步地,計算目標圖像相對參考圖像的視差值包括:將目標圖像進行區域分割,得到多個預設大小的區域窗口圖像;在每個區域窗口圖像中選擇任意一個像素點,計算被選像素點相對參考圖像的視差值;以及以被選像素點為種子點,通過區域生長算法分別計算各個區域窗口圖像中像素點相對參考圖像的視差值。
進一步地,多個區域窗口包括第一區域窗口和第二區域窗口,通過區域生長算法計算第一區域窗口圖像中像素點相對參考圖像的視差值包括:計算第一像素點相對參考圖像的視差值,其中,第一像素點為第一區域窗口圖像中的像素點;計算第二像素點與參考圖像中對應像素點的相關值,其中,第二像素點與第一像素點相鄰;在相關值大于或等于第一預設閾值時,確定第二像素點相對參考圖像的視差值等于第一像素點相對參考圖像的視差值;在相關值小于或等于第二預設閾值時,確定第二像素點為陰影點,其中,第二預設可信閾值小于第一可信閾值;以及在相關值小于第一預設閾值且大于第二預設閾值時,根據第二區域窗口圖像中像素點相對參考圖像的視差值計算第二像素點相對參考圖像的視差值。
進一步地,采用以下方法計算目標圖像中像素點與參考圖像中像素點的相關值:在目標圖像中獲取子圖像,得到第一子圖像,其中,第一子圖像為在目標圖像中,以目標圖像中像素點為坐標原點、X方向上的像素點數為m且Y方向上的像素點數為n的區域的圖像;在參考圖像中獲取子圖像,得到第二子圖像,其中,第二子圖像為在參考圖像中,以參考圖像中像素點為坐標原點、X方向上的像素點數為m且Y方向上的像素點數為n的區域的圖像;以及采用以下公式計算第一子圖像與第二子圖像的相關值:
該專利技術資料僅供研究查看技術是否侵權等信息,商用須獲得專利權人授權。該專利全部權利屬于北京數碼視訊科技股份有限公司,未經北京數碼視訊科技股份有限公司許可,擅自商用是侵權行為。如果您想購買此專利、獲得商業授權和技術合作,請聯系【客服】
本文鏈接:http://www.szxzyx.cn/pat/books/201210166092.1/2.html,轉載請聲明來源鉆瓜專利網。





